wjones 7eb2b445cb Postgres perf, path migration, and shutdown race fixes
- Major query performance boost: replaced correlated subqueries with DistinctBy() in BaseItemRepository, added episode deduplication index, and increased default command timeout to 120s.
- Fixed LibraryMonitor shutdown race: added disposal checks and exception handling in FileRefresher to prevent ObjectDisposedException.
- Added PowerShell and SQL utilities for fixing Linux paths in config files and database; new scripts for WebDir and path migration.
- Auto-fix for WebDir in startup.json on load; new helper scripts and docs.
- Added automated weekly DB performance monitoring scripts and reporting.
- Expanded documentation and README for all fixes, scripts, and migration steps.
- Updated SQL scripts for index creation and diagnostics; improved output handling.
- Updated db-config defaults and added new diagnostic/report files.

// <copyright file="FileRefresher.cs" company="PlaceholderCompany">
// Copyright (c) PlaceholderCompany. All rights reserved.
// </copyright>
#pragma warning disable CS1591
using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.IO;
using System.Linq;
using System.Threading;
using MediaBrowser.Controller.Configuration;
using MediaBrowser.Controller.Entities;
using MediaBrowser.Controller.Library;
using Microsoft.Extensions.Logging;
namespace Emby.Server.Implementations.IO
{
public sealed class FileRefresher : IDisposable
{
private readonly ILogger _logger;
private readonly ILibraryManager _libraryManager;
private readonly IServerConfigurationManager _configurationManager;
private readonly List<string> _affectedPaths = new();
private readonly Lock _timerLock = new();
private Timer? _timer;
private bool _disposed;
public FileRefresher(string path, IServerConfigurationManager configurationManager, ILibraryManager libraryManager, ILogger logger)
{
logger.LogDebug("New file refresher created for {0}", path);
Path = path;
_configurationManager = configurationManager;
_libraryManager = libraryManager;
_logger = logger;
AddPath(path);
}
public event EventHandler<EventArgs>? Completed;
public string Path { get; private set; }
private void AddAffectedPath(string path)
{
ArgumentException.ThrowIfNullOrEmpty(path);
if (!_affectedPaths.Contains(path, StringComparer.Ordinal))
{
_affectedPaths.Add(path);
}
}
public void AddPath(string path)
{
ArgumentException.ThrowIfNullOrEmpty(path);
lock (_timerLock)
{
AddAffectedPath(path);
}
RestartTimer();
}
public void RestartTimer()
{
if (_disposed)
{
return;
}
lock (_timerLock)
{
if (_disposed)
{
return;
}
if (_timer is null)
{
_timer = new Timer(OnTimerCallback, null, TimeSpan.FromSeconds(_configurationManager.Configuration.LibraryMonitorDelay), TimeSpan.FromMilliseconds(-1));
}
else
{
_timer.Change(TimeSpan.FromSeconds(_configurationManager.Configuration.LibraryMonitorDelay), TimeSpan.FromMilliseconds(-1));
}
}
}
public void ResetPath(string path, string? affectedFile)
{
lock (_timerLock)
{
_logger.LogDebug("Resetting file refresher from {0} to {1}", Path, path);
Path = path;
AddAffectedPath(path);
if (!string.IsNullOrEmpty(affectedFile))
{
AddAffectedPath(affectedFile);
}
}
RestartTimer();
}
private void OnTimerCallback(object? state)
{
// Check if disposed before processing
if (_disposed)
{
return;
}
List<string> paths;
lock (_timerLock)
{
paths = _affectedPaths.ToList();
}
_logger.LogDebug("Timer stopped.");
DisposeTimer();
Completed?.Invoke(this, EventArgs.Empty);
// Double-check disposal after timer is disposed
if (_disposed)
{
return;
}
try
{
ProcessPathChanges(paths);
}
catch (Exception ex)
{
_logger.LogError(ex, "Error processing directory changes");
}
}
private void ProcessPathChanges(List<string> paths)
{
// Check if disposed before accessing services
if (_disposed)
{
return;
}
IEnumerable<BaseItem> itemsToRefresh;
try
{
itemsToRefresh = paths
.Distinct()
.Select(GetAffectedBaseItem)
.Where(item => item is not null)
.DistinctBy(x => x!.Id)!; // Removed null values in the previous .Where()
}
catch (ObjectDisposedException)
{
// Service provider has been disposed during shutdown, skip processing
_logger.LogDebug("Service provider disposed during path change processing, skipping refresh");
return;
}
foreach (var item in itemsToRefresh)
{
if (item is AggregateFolder)
{
continue;
}
_logger.LogInformation("{Name} ({Path}) will be refreshed.", item.Name, item.Path);
try
{
item.ChangedExternally();
}
catch (Exception ex)
{
_logger.LogError(ex, "Error refreshing {Name}", item.Name);
}
}
}
/// <summary>
/// Gets the affected base item.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="path">The path.</param>
/// <returns>BaseItem.</returns>
private BaseItem? GetAffectedBaseItem(string path)
{
BaseItem? item = null;
while (item is null && !string.IsNullOrEmpty(path))
{
item = _libraryManager.FindByPath(path, null);
path = System.IO.Path.GetDirectoryName(path) ?? string.Empty;
}
if (item is not null)
{
// If the item has been deleted find the first valid parent that still exists
while (!Directory.Exists(item.Path) && !File.Exists(item.Path))
{
item = item.GetOwner() ?? item.GetParent();
if (item is null)
{
break;
}
}
}
return item;
}
private void DisposeTimer()
{
lock (_timerLock)
{
if (_timer is not null)
{
_timer.Dispose();
_timer = null;
}
}
}
/// <inheritdoc />
public void Dispose()
{
if (_disposed)
{
return;
}
DisposeTimer();
_disposed = true;
}
}
}
